To: 21twelve

Part of the problem, I think, is that a lot of groups/artists (RUSH included) felt like thy had to do/say/write/sing something of “relevance” to the event. Everything I’ve heard sounds self-conscious, subdued, and artless. No one could even simply make a good sad song.

It seems with country music, however, there were songs at-hand to sing and play in response to the event. Sad songs, patriotic songs, stirring songs... They didn’t need the event for them to be written. They were made and played already!
